Artists of the Civilian Conservation Corps
Author Kathleen Duxbury shares the Great Depression story of a young, untried Waukegan artist with a romantic name, Reima Victor Ratti. This talk shares details of the artist's days in the CCC and how that experience set him on a path to history. See the artist's work on display in the temporary exhibit.
